Historical Context: This silver Obol from Pharsalos dates to 450-400 BC. Pharsalos, a prominent Thessalian polis, was famed for its fertile plains and formidable cavalry, crucial in inter-city conflicts and wider Greek affairs, including the Peloponnesian War.
